Description
With sweeping views over Carl Schurz Park and the East River, this rarely available ten-room residence at 130 East End Avenue epitomizes the artistry of Emery Roth. Sunlight streams through its windows throughout the day, illuminating a home of exceptional scale, grace, and architectural distinction. A magnificent central gallery introduces the home and connects to all major rooms, setting the stage for both elegant entertaining and private living. The living room is luminous and inviting, anchored by a wood-burning fireplace and framed by unobstructed views across the park to the river. The dining room is exceptional in scale, an airy and sun-filled setting for gatherings both large and intimate. The private bedroom wing features a serene corner primary suite with double exposures, abundant closet space, and a windowed bath. Two additional bedrooms, each with generous walk-in closets, capture open northern light and charming townhouse views. One enjoys its own windowed en suite bath, while the other shares a bath with the adjoining library, a versatile room with northern views that may serve as a fourth bedroom. The expansive eat-in kitchen is complemented by a walk-in pantry, a separate laundry room vented to the outside, and an additional suite created from former staff rooms with two exposures and a full bath, ideal for office space or guests. Throughout, the home retains original prewar details, including hardwood floors, ceiling heights over nine feet, and exceptional proportions. This residence offers a chance to create a truly special home on East End Avenue. Built in 1929, 130 East End Avenue is a distinguished white-glove cooperative by Emery Roth. Residents enjoy a 24-hour attended lobby, attentive staff, and a tranquil East End Avenue location with immediate access to Carl Schurz Park, Asphalt Green, and top schools. Pets are welcome with board approval. Offering refined service and an idyllic setting along the East River, 130 East End Avenue remains one of the neighborhoods most coveted addresses. 2% flip tax paid by buyer.
